您现在的位置是:首页 > 要闻简讯 > 互联网络科技动态 > 正文
揭秘 Microsoft 的 .NET Framework:定义、特点与应用
发布时间:2024-12-04 00:50:16来源:
一、什么是 .NET Framework?
Microsoft 的 .NET Framework(简称“.NET”)是一个开源的跨平台框架,它提供了一系列构建 Web 应用、控制台应用和服务的方法。简单来说,它就是一种创建和开发软件的平台。通过 .NET Framework,开发者可以使用多种语言(如 C#, VB.NET 等)来编写应用程序,并能够在不同的操作系统和设备上运行。这种灵活性使得开发人员能够更高效地编写代码,并帮助用户构建可靠、安全的软件解决方案。
二、.NET Framework 的特点
1. 跨平台性:可以在各种操作系统(如 Windows、Linux 和 macOS)上运行。随着技术的不断进步,越来越多的开发人员和企业正在采用跨平台解决方案。
2. 多语言支持:支持多种编程语言,包括 C#, VB.NET 等。这使得开发者可以根据自己的需求和技能选择合适的编程语言。
3. 可扩展性:提供了一个庞大的类库集合,包括数据访问、网络编程等常用功能,方便开发者快速构建应用程序。同时,它还支持第三方库和插件的集成,从而增强应用程序的功能。
4. 安全性:提供了强大的安全机制,包括身份验证、加密和代码访问安全等,确保应用程序和用户数据的安全。
三、.NET Framework 的应用
由于具备跨平台性和强大的功能,.NET Framework 被广泛应用于各种软件开发领域。以下是一些主要的应用场景:
1. Web 开发:可用于构建各种规模的 Web 应用程序,包括电子商务网站、社交网络等。借助 ASP.NET 技术,开发者可以轻松地创建高性能的 Web 应用。
2. 桌面应用开发:用于开发桌面应用程序,如办公软件、图像处理软件等。这些应用程序可以在 Windows 操作系统上运行,并为用户提供丰富的交互体验。
3. 移动应用开发:尽管 .NET Framework 主要用于桌面和 Web 应用开发,但随着技术的发展,它也被应用于移动应用开发领域。例如,Xamarin 是一个基于 .NET 的移动应用开发框架,允许开发者使用 C# 语言编写跨平台的移动应用。
4. 游戏开发:许多游戏开发者也使用 .NET Framework 来构建游戏引擎和游戏逻辑。它的高性能和灵活性使得它成为游戏开发的一个理想选择。
总之,Microsoft 的 .NET Framework 是一个强大的跨平台框架,为开发者提供了丰富的工具和库来构建各种类型的应用程序。随着技术的不断进步和开源社区的发展,它在软件开发领域的应用将会越来越广泛。
标签:
关于RM格式:深入了解与实际应用 下一篇
最后一页
猜你喜欢
最新文章
- 揭秘 Microsoft 的 .NET Framework:定义、特点与应用
- 速热电热器的核心优势与选择指南
- 如何轻松更改桌面图标——一步步打造个性化桌面
- 酷狗音乐网:探索音乐的无限魅力
- 佳能ixus300相机深度评测与操作指南
- 关于RM格式:深入了解与实际应用
- 关于最新1394采集卡:使用指南与特点解析
- BDHD关键词锁定:探索未来技术与智能家居的深度融合
- 显卡驱动是否需要更新?最新更新指南帮你解答疑惑!
- 联想G405:性能卓越的实用笔记本
- Foxit Phantom PDF阅读器的优势与功能介绍
- 独特魅力的QQ空间签名设计指南
- 揭秘T6570的神秘面纱:全方位解析性能特点与技术应用
- 拼多多投诉电话人工服务,快速解决您的问题!
- 富士S205EXR——高性能中端数码相机的最佳选择
- "无法上网问题解决指南:从根源探寻原因,助您重回网络世界"
- 致命错误0xc000005的原因与解决方案
- 图层合并技术详解:操作指南与最佳实践
- LG G6:超越想象的智能科技体验
- 揭秘数字968:一场跨越时空的神秘之旅
- 黄钻官网:尊贵身份的专属领地,解锁独家特权!
- e5450:全新科技与卓越性能的完美结合
- 海美迪Q5:新一代家庭娱乐中心的卓越表现
- K9080全新升级:探索科技与艺术的融合之作